How It Works

1
Create Project

Start by naming your DCO campaign project

2
Add Content

Input your titles, subtitles, and upload background images

3
Generate Variations

Automatically create all possible combinations

4
Export & Use

Download or push selected variations to Canva

Project Selection

Create a new project or select an existing one to manage your DCO campaigns

No project selected

Ready to Start

Create your first DCO project to get started with generating dynamic variations

Canva API Connection Test

Status:Not connected

Environment Check:

Client ID: Set
Base URL: https://www.dco-tool.com

Instructions:

  1. Ensure your environment variables are set in .env.local
  2. Click "Connect to Canva" to start OAuth flow
  3. Authorize the application in the popup window
  4. Check that the status changes to "Connected"